The NIS-2 Implementation Act has come into force – are you affected?
The NIS-2 Implementation Act has been in force since 6 December 2025 and sets new standards for cyber and information security in Germany. Under the Act, binding legal obligations now apply to a significantly larger number of organisations. For the first time, around 30,000 organisations are required to implement comprehensive technical and organisational security measures to protect their networks and information systems.
From risk management systems and attack detection to strict reporting requirements – these requirements are designed to ensure a consistent and appropriate level of security across the EU.

The NIS 2 Implementation Act: How to improve your cyber security with GKK
The entry into force of the Act marks the start of a new phase in cybersecurity regulation in Germany: it provides greater legal certainty, whilst at the same time increasing the responsibilities of company management and extending information security obligations to a large number of small and medium-sized enterprises.
Failure to comply with the prescribed measures may not only result in substantial fines for the company, but may also lead to personal liability claims against the management.
